Entry-Level Medical Coder Salary in Ontario, CA: $33,911 (2026)
Quick Answer:New medical coders entering the Ontario, CA job market in 2026 can expect a starting salary around $33,911 (BLS 10th-percentile benchmark for SOC 29-2072, projected from 2025 OEWS data). Stripping out Ontario's local price level (BEA RPP 113.1 — 13% above national), a first-year paycheck buys what $29,983 would in average-cost America. Most reach the city median ($48,805) within a few years of clinical practice.

CPC, CCS Salary Negotiation Tips for New Graduates in Ontario
- 1Research the Ontario market: entry-level medical coder pay ranges from $33,911 to $40,197, so aim for at least the 25th percentile if you have strong credentials.
- 2Highlight any additional certifications or specialty training within the medical coding field — employers in CA often pay a premium for expanded scope of work.
- 3Evaluate the full compensation package — in Ontario, benefits like health insurance, continuing-education allowances, and schedule flexibility can add 20-30% to your effective compensation.
- 4Consider starting with a larger hospital system or multi-site employer in Ontario for competitive entry-level pay and structured mentorship, then move to a smaller employer once you have 2-3 years of experience.
- 5Factor in Ontario's above-average cost of living (index: 113.1) when evaluating offers — a slightly lower salary in a nearby affordable area may provide better purchasing power.
